Electric fan not working
I noticed today my jeep was startin to over heat while idling in my garage and I didnt hear the elec fan running. So I opened the hood and stuck a volt meter in the plug and I got .01(out of 20)volts going through so Im thinking theres gotta be a relay or something somewhere that went bad I was going to use jumpers from battery to the fans plug but Im not real sure if its a 12v(my battery reads alomost 14) fan so I didnt want to see what would happen.

Just a note on checking to see if the fan is bad or not. With the engine idling turn on your A/C. The fan is set to turn on when the A/C is switched on.
